Gouri calls for new farm reform movement

Special Correspondent

Receives P.S. John award from Speaker

KOCHI: Janadhipathya Samrakshana Samithy leader and one of the architects of Kerala's agrarian reforms K.R. Gouri has called for a new agricultural reform movement that will increase food production.

Ms. Gouri said the first agrarian reform, carried out by the Communist Government, had not achieved its main goal of increasing production. Of course, it had ended bonded labour and feudal practices in the farm sector.

She was speaking after receiving the P.S. John Endowment award of the Ernakulam Press Club from Speaker K. Radhakrishnan here on Wednesday.

The 87-year-old Ms. Gouri, the 11th winner of the annual prize set up in memory of the late Malayala Manorama journalist, was chosen for her all-round contribution to the advancement of Kerala society. She said she would hand over the Rs.10,000 prize money to a home for the care of mentally challenged persons at Menamkulam in Thiruvananthapuram district.

Ms. Gauri urged the media to strive for women's empowerment. She noted that in spite of the all-round development of the State, women were still mostly confined to the kitchen. She said she had struggled hard to get the law on Women's Commission enacted, though this had been largely forgotten. She recalled that her short stint as a lawyer had helped her in her role as MLA, Minister and politician.

Speaker Radhakrishnan, praising Ms. Gouri's political career spanning six decades, pointed out that she was a rare phenomenon in the whole of the country as she had consecutively contested all the 13 Assembly elections so far in the State, and won 11 of them.
